An independent insurance agent in Waterbury acts as your personal advocate, not just a salesperson for a single brand. Unlike captive agents who represent only one company, independent agents work with multiple top-rated insurance carriers. This allows them to shop around on your behalf, comparing policies and prices to find the best fit for your specific needs.
Choosing an independent agent means you gain access to a broad spectrum of insurance products without having to contact dozens of companies yourself. They provide unbiased advice and local expertise, ensuring you get comprehensive coverage at competitive rates. This personalized approach is a distinct advantage over relying on national 800-numbers or single-brand storefronts.

Coverage typically available
When exploring auto and home insurance in Waterbury, an independent agent can present bundled options, often leading to significant savings. They compare various combinations of liability limits, comprehensive and collision deductibles, and dwelling coverage amounts across different carriers, ensuring you get robust protection for your vehicles and property under one convenient package.
For life insurance and long-term planning, you'll find options ranging from term life insurance, which covers you for a specific period, to permanent life insurance, which provides lifelong coverage and often builds cash value. Your agent can help you evaluate which type best aligns with your financial goals, family needs, and budget here in Waterbury.
Health and supplemental coverage includes a spectrum of choices from comprehensive plans offered on the federal health insurance marketplace to short-term medical plans for temporary needs. Additionally, agents can discuss supplemental policies that help cover out-of-pocket costs like deductibles or co-pays, providing extra financial security for Waterbury residents.
Small business insurance in Waterbury typically involves comparing a Business Owner's Policy (BOP), which bundles property, liability, and business interruption coverage, with standalone policies for specific risks. Agents can also help you explore options for workers' compensation, commercial auto, or professional liability, depending on your business's unique operations.

For any insurance consumer in Waterbury, the Nebraska Department of Insurance is an essential state resource. They provide regulatory oversight for insurance companies and agents operating in the state, offering consumer protection and information regarding insurance laws and rights. You can access their resources for general inquiries or to verify an agent's license.
Various consumer protection bureaus, both at the state and national level, also serve to safeguard your interests when shopping for insurance. These organizations can offer guidance if you have concerns about a policy or a company, ensuring transparency in the insurance marketplace.
When meeting with an independent agent in Waterbury, be prepared to ask about their experience, the range of carriers they represent, and how they handle claims or policy changes. Inquire about available discounts, bundling options, and how they assess your specific risk factors to tailor the best coverage for you.
Many free online price-comparison tools can give you a preliminary idea of insurance costs, but remember these often don't capture the full picture or the personalized advice an independent agent can offer. They are best used as a starting point before consulting with a local expert who can delve deeper into your unique situation.
